Hi all !
I've been playing with Xen 4.0.1 from tarball together with 2.6.37 as dom0 and 
have a problem - I am able to see Xen boot messages and dom0 ones on console 
but 
have no interaction with getty after dom0 finish booting. I've probably missed 
something in GRUB configuration. Here is what I have now :
......
kernel /boot/xen4.0.gz console=vga vga=mode-0x0f00,keep
module /boot/vmlinuz-2.6.37xen root=/dev/sda5 ro console=hvc0 console=tty0
With that conf I would like to have boot messages (Xen + dom0) visible and 
ability to log on. Am I thinking right ? 
Without all these xen and kernel console stuff I get blank screen as soon as
dom0 start booting.
Maybe I should set something while compiling Xen itself or dom0 kernel ?
